How they compare

Fiji currently reports 246.70 million current LCU against 196.30 million current LCU in Jordan, a difference of 50.40 million current LCU.

That makes Fiji's figure about 1.3 times Jordan's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 21 shared years of data; in 1994 it was Jordan ahead.

Globally, Fiji ranks 134th and Jordan ranks 135th of 149 countries.

Other expense is spending on dividends, rent, and other miscellaneous expenses, including provision for consumption of fixed capital.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This series is expressed in local currency units.
